  • Housebuilding 3/4
    Mar 15 2025

    Rob and Alex examine how, since the 90s, the UK has ended up with historically low rates of house building and soaring prices. Despite low interest rates, high availability of labour, and high demand for housing. Discussing the planning system, market structure and incentives on developers.

  • Housebuilding 2/4
    Mar 15 2025

    Rob and Alex explore how post-WW2 governments tried to meet the urgent need for need housing after the war, despite a restrictive new planning system, labour shortages and high interest rates. And raised house building to its highest ever level, whilst causing yet another political backlash - against ugly new council estates.
